Hello fellow Bowsers, I have a question for you all.

Lately, I've been trying to learn the grab releases for the Top/High tier characters, and I'm having a bit of trouble with the regrabs/Klaws out of ground releases. I usually start tapping A as soon as I grab and wait for the ground release and then try to go for the regrab. However, I encounter two problems at this point :

1. For some reason it seems my tapping A carries over, and Bowser does jabs out of the ground release while I try to input a regrab motion. It's not terrible, but it's not what I'm trying to do.

2. I'll go for the regrab, but I guess I timed it wrong because they roll away before I can regrab, or it looks like Bowser can't reach them and he completely misses.

So I guess what I'm saying is, do you guys repeatedly tap A for max damage, or do you just tap it a few times and wait for what release occurs so you can react better? Also, how do you time your regrabs if you DO tap A repeatedly, and similarly if you don't?

Thanks, if I can get this figured out it should help my game immensely.

You can press Z to pummel. I haven't implemented the regrab in my game, but the maneuver is based on reaction. Try double-tapping the control stick forwards as soon as you see them break out and press Z.

What I do to Klaw and is best imo (which isn't worth much, unfortunately) is to slide your finger over the B button and then press A. You're still hitting him, but that Klaw will come out first since you're hitting the B button first.

If you're using the Gamecube Controller, it works.

They've already talked about the regrab, but no one mentioned the Klaw as well so I figured it wouldn't hurt to add it in
